Irregular period cause issues with ttc?

Hello everyone!!!! I hope you are doing well!  My husband and I are trying to conceive our first child. He is 30, and I am 25. I have an irregular period. On Yaz, I had a predictable period schedule that was about 27-32 days. Now, that I am back off the dreaded pill, my period is back to its crazy ways. I can go months without a period (without being pregnant).

Does anyone else have these issues?  What do you do? I just bought the First Response Ovulation kit and have started taking my temp in the morning.  I want to also do the cervix mucus, but I am completely unsure of how that works. :/

  • It's definitely possible that you are having cycles where you don't ovulate.  Or they could just be crazy.  Temping will help you make that determination as will OPKs.  You can check your CM one of two ways - either externally whenever you wipe, or internally by inserting a finger or 2 into your vagina, swirling them around your cervix and seeing what comes out.  I have to do it this way because I rarely get anything externally

  • I had the same problem when I got off bcp....I would go almost 90 days without AF.  I ended up scheduling an appointment with my gyno and he ran some tests and discovered that I have PCOS.  He prescribed metformin and recommended that I start taking a PNV.  Since starting the metformin, my cycle has become more regular.  Maybe you should talk with your doctor.

  • As many people had said- Read Taking Charge of Your Fertility and charting on Fertility Friend. I had insane cycles after BC and just recently got diagnosed with Polycystic Ovarian Syndrome. That was the reason I could go months without having a period. If you chart your temperatures, it can give you some indication as to whether or not you are actually ovulating.
